To inform, inspire, motivate, and connect!
These are the outcomes that the UFS Department of Alumni Relations wants to achieve through its Alumni Career Connect engagement series.
The series connects pre-alumni with leading alumni who have experience as leaders in various careers, entrepreneurship, personal and professional success.
The content and themes further aim to prepare pre-alumni for the world of work and life beyond graduation.
Dr Roy Jankielsohn is the Leader of the Official Opposition in the Free State Legislature and the DA Free State Provincial Leader. Formerly a Lecturer in the Department of Political Science at UFS (1995-2000), he was a Member of Parliament (2000-2006) during which he served as the DA’s Spokesperson on Defence and Safety and Security (Policing).
Join us as we experience Dr Jankielsohn’s personal and professional success.

World Wide Web discussed at UFS
2006-09-08
The eighth annual congress on World Wide Web applications was attended by about 200 delegates from countries across the world on the Main Campus of the University of the Free State (UFS) in Bloemfontein. The congress was presented by the UFS and the Central University of Technology. Topics like e-learning, e-business, e-governance and e-community were discussed. A direct broadcast of the keynote address, delivered by Mr Stephen Downes from the National Research Council in Canada, was done by means of a Skypecast broadcast.
